Secret life of rats

Thank you for “Respect For Rats” (March 20), which illustrates the fact that rodents are highly emotional and intelligent.

For example, they provide help according to need, sharing food with those who need it most. In an experiment, hungry rats given food by other rats reciprocated by offering a grooming. In another experiment, rats came across other rats who were trapped. Tempted with chocolate, the free rats chose to rescue the trapped rats instead of eating.

This is why it’s heartbreaking to know that all day, every day, rodents suffer tremendously as they get stuck in glue traps. We can co-exist with rodents while refraining from brutalizing them.
